Subject: possible missing dependency for python-numpy and proposed fix
To: cygwin AT cygwin DOT com
X-IsSubscribed: yes

Hi,

I recently installed a new version of Cygwin on a new Windows 7
machine.  I installed a several packages including numpy.  The
installation worked without any errors.  I did this for both 32 and 64
bit versions of Cygwin.

After installing numpy I tried importing it in a Python shell.  It
raised an ImportError exception when trying to import lapack_lite.
Lapack_lite.dll existed in the correct location, but running "cygcheck
-c" (as per http://cygwin.com/ml/cygwin/2013-05/msg00361.html) on it
revealed that it needed libquadmath0 which had not been installed.
Numpy worked fine once I installed the missing libquadmath0
dependency.

Is anyone else seeing this problem?  Should this dependency be added
to the numpy setup.hint?
